Ordinals
beta
Address 1ME6w9hthDHv4m9Lq46t3SX1i2oLULwCEe
sat balance
38253
outputs
01cb2c023fa87005d5c41246d50390ea4aa6ed434de94b7411f7c78ea44feef9:167